Adult Fiction book review

Forrest for the Trees by Kilby Blades

Librarian Laura’s Review

Sierra Betts is a Park Ranger in the beautiful Great Smokey Mountains National Park. Being a female Park Ranger in a profession mostly of males proves difficult enough, but Sierra also has to deal with the added detail of being a Black female Park Ranger. Though she values her boss, Olivia, and works her butt off on a daily basis, there are some males in the Greenbrier Ranger Station who treat her unkindly, namely Dennis, who is unfortunately aiming to get the very same job promotion that Sierra has had her mind set on for a while. Sierra keeps the other Rangers happy with a steady supply of delicious food, and her bacon bites are the stuff of legend.

Enter one Forrest Rivers, a tall, manly, white, bearded hunk of a man, beloved by all in Green Valley, Tennessee. Forrest is a Federal Fire Marshall, and he spends a good bit of time in and out of the Greenbrier Ranger Station, much to Sierra’s discomfort. She can’t deny that he’s easy on the eyes, sauntering in with his good looks and his fire axe, but he loves to get her riled up and steal the bacon bites meant for the Park Rangers.

After a series of arson fires in Sierra’s designated patrol area of the Park, Sierra has to tamp down her annoyance of Forrest, in order to work alongside him and try to solve the case. Once they begin working together, Sierra realizes that Forrest is more than just a big, beefy, good looking man. As it turns out, Forrest is a bit of a charmer with a gentle nature Sierra finds herself enjoying more and more. After being looked over and not appreciated for all her hard work on the job, Sierra finds the respect and admiration from Forrest to be a breath of fresh air in the Tennessee heat.

Forrest for the Trees is a small town, enemies-to-lovers romance that you won’t want to miss. The chemistry between Forrest and Sierra is sizzling and well-written. Green Valley fans will delight in cameos from both Sheriff Jeffrey and Deputy Jackson James, as well in scenes set in the Donner Bakery and the infamous Green Valley Public Library. This story brought me back fond memories of my undying love for the Park Ranger series by Daisy Prescott (Happy Trail and Stranger Ranger).

About the Book

Forrest for the Trees, an all new slow burn small town romance from Kilby Blades, is coming September 30th to Kindle Unlimited! Kilby kicks off the brand new Green Valley Heroes series in the Smartypants Romance Universe with her enemies to lovers standalone!

Forrest Winters isn’t just a federal fire marshal; he’s a thorn in Ranger Sierra Betts’s side. The way he swings his big axe, fixes her with his chameleon gray eyes, and talks about his jurisdiction has a way of breaking her concentration. He has a way of showing up everywhere he doesn’t belong, including Greenbrier Ranger Station. And he really needs to quit stealing her bacon bites.

When a series of suspicious fires, an underhanded co-worker, and a cagey Parks Police Chief threaten her job and the park itself, Sierra grudgingly agrees to partner with Forrest. Their side investigation may be her best shot at preventing the framing of an innocent man. But can his firefighting expertise and her detective skills lead them to the real arsonist before Forrest breaks her with his charm?

‘Forrest for the Trees’ is a full-length contemporary romance, can be read as a standalone and is book #1 in the Green Valley Heroes series, Green Valley Chronicles, Penny Reid Book Universe.
